Opening 'Zukunft Bau' Pop-up Campus
Event Description
This year, Zukunft Bau is testing a new format for the first time that bridges the gap between the latest findings from science, their translation into practical building applications, and their communication to a broad audience. For a period of 3 months, an existing area in the host city of Aachen will be transformed into an experimental space that allows for creative testing of new construction approaches: The Zukunft Bau Pop-up Campus. For this purpose, a currently vacant building ensemble within walking distance of the main train station will be temporarily converted. With a focus on the goal of a climate-neutral building stock in 2045, innovative approaches for the construction of the future will be generated and demonstrated.
